📄 wpshapes.html
字号:
<CODE> <A HREF="../../../../../application/workbooks/workbook/documents/document/wpshapes/WpShape.html" title="application.workbooks.workbook.documents.document.wpshapes 中的类">WpShape</A></CODE></FONT></TD>
<TD><CODE><B><A HREF="../../../../../application/workbooks/workbook/documents/document/WpShapes.html#getShape(java.lang.String)">getShape</A></B>(java.lang.String shapeName)</CODE>
<BR>
根据名字获取图形对象。</TD>
</TR>
<TR BGCOLOR="white" CLASS="TableRowColor">
<T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1">
<CODE> <A HREF="../../../../../application/workbooks/workbook/documents/document/wpshapes/WpShape.html" title="application.workbooks.workbook.documents.document.wpshapes 中的类">WpShape</A>[]</CODE></FONT></TD>
<TD><CODE><B><A HREF="../../../../../application/workbooks/workbook/documents/document/WpShapes.html#getShapes(java.lang.String)">getShapes</A></B>(java.lang.String name)</CODE>
<BR>
根据名称返回自选图形数组。</TD>
</TR>
<TR BGCOLOR="white" CLASS="TableRowColor">
<T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1">
<CODE> boolean</CODE></FONT></TD>
<TD><CODE><B><A HREF="../../../../../application/workbooks/workbook/documents/document/WpShapes.html#isAnchorVisible()">isAnchorVisible</A></B>()</CODE>
<BR>
判断文档中自选图形的锚点是否可见。</TD>
</TR>
<TR BGCOLOR="white" CLASS="TableRowColor">
<TD ALIGN="right" VALIGN="top" WIDTH="1%"><FONT SIZE="-1">
<CODE> void</CODE></FONT></TD>
<TD><CODE><B><A HREF="../../../../../application/workbooks/workbook/documents/document/WpShapes.html#setAnchorVisible(boolean)">setAnchorVisible</A></B>(boolean visible)</CODE>
<BR>
设置文档中自选图形的锚点是否可见。</TD>
</TR>
</TABLE>
<A NAME="methods_inherited_from_class_application.workbooks.workbook.Shapes"><!-- --></A>
<T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Y="">
<TR BGCOLOR="#EEEEFF" CLASS="TableSubHeadingColor">
<TH ALIGN="left"><B>从类 application.workbooks.workbook.<A HREF="../../../../../application/workbooks/workbook/Shapes.html" title="application.workbooks.workbook 中的类">Shapes</A> 继承的方法</B></TH>
</TR>
<TR BGCOLOR="white" CLASS="TableRowColor">
<TD><CODE><A HREF="../../../../../application/workbooks/workbook/Shapes.html#addConnector(int, double, double, double, double)">addConnector</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#addDataObject(application.doors.DataObject, double, double, double, double)">addDataObject</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#addLine(int, double, double, double, double)">addLine</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#addPicture(java.lang.String)">addPicture</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#addShape(int, double, double, double, double)">addShape</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#addTextBox(int, double, double, double, double)">addTextBox</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#addWordArt(int, java.lang.String, java.lang.String, int, int, double, double, double, double)">addWordArt</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#insertFraction()">insertFraction</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#isLineDrawing()">isLineDrawing</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#isSelectAll()">isSelectAll</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#selectAll()">selectAll</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#selectRange(java.lang.String[])">selectRange</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#size()">size</A>, <A HREF="../../../../../application/workbooks/workbook/Shapes.html#unSelect()">unSelect</A></CODE></TD>
</TR>
</TABLE>
<A NAME="methods_inherited_from_class_java.lang.Object"><!-- --></A>
<T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Y="">
<TR BGCOLOR="#EEEEFF" CLASS="TableSubHeadingColor">
<TH ALIGN="left"><B>从类 java.lang.Object 继承的方法</B></TH>
</TR>
<TR BGCOLOR="white" CLASS="TableRowColor">
<TD><CODE>equ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ait</CODE></TD>
</TR>
</TABLE>
<P>
<!-- ============ METHOD DETAIL ========== -->
<A NAME="method_detail"><!-- --></A>
<TABLE BORDER="1" WIDTH="100%" CELLPADDING="3" CELLSPACING="0" SUMMARY="">
<TR BGCOLOR="#CCCCFF" CLASS="TableHeadingColor">
<TH ALIGN="left" COLSPAN="1"><FONT SIZE="+2">
<B>方法详细信息</B></FONT></TH>
</TR>
</TABLE>
<A NAME="addDocField(java.lang.String, double, double, double)"><!-- --></A><H3>
addDocField</H3>
<PRE>
public <A HREF="../../../../../application/workbooks/workbook/shapes/DocField.html" title="application.workbooks.workbook.shapes 中的类">DocField</A> <B>addDocField</B>(java.lang.String text,
double startX,
double startY,
double endX)</PRE>
<DL>
<DD>添加一个公文域。
<P>
<DD><DL>
<DT><B>覆盖:</B><DD>类 <CODE><A HREF="../../../../../application/workbooks/workbook/Shapes.html" title="application.workbooks.workbook 中的类">Shapes</A></CODE> 中的 <CODE><A HREF="../../../../../application/workbooks/workbook/Shapes.html#addDocField(java.lang.String, double, double, double)">addDocField</A></CODE></DL>
</DD>
<DD><DL>
<DT><B>参数:</B><DD><CODE>text</CODE> - 公文域的内容<DD><CODE>startX</CODE> - 左上角的x坐标<DD><CODE>startY</CODE> - 左上角的y坐标<DD><CODE>endX</CODE> - 右下角的x坐标<DD><CODE>endY</CODE> - 右下角的y坐标
<DT><B>返回:</B><DD>返回插入公文域对象 <p> <b>例子:</b> <pre> //在文字处理中添加一文本为"发送机关"的公文域。 Shapes shapes = Application.getWorkbooks().getActiveWorkbook().getActiveShapes(); shapes.addDocField("发文机关", 120, 180, 380); </pre>
<DT><B>抛出:</B>
<DD><CODE><A HREF="../../../../../application/exceptions/MacroRunException.html" title="application.exceptions 中的类">MacroRunException</A></CODE> - 当无法插入公文域,或者并非在文字处理中插入时。</DL>
</DD>
</DL>
<HR>
<A NAME="addDocField(java.lang.String, double, double, double, double)"><!-- --></A><H3>
addDocField</H3>
<PRE>
public java.lang.String <B>addDocField</B>(java.lang.String text,
double startX,
double startY,
double endX,
double endY)</PRE>
<DL>
<DD>添加一个公文域。
<P>
<DD><DL>
<DT><B>覆盖:</B><DD>类 <CODE><A HREF="../../../../../application/workbooks/workbook/Shapes.html" title="application.workbooks.workbook 中的类">Shapes</A></CODE> 中的 <CODE><A HREF="../../../../../application/workbooks/workbook/Shapes.html#addDocField(java.lang.String, double, double, double, double)">addDocField</A></CODE></DL>
</DD>
<DD><DL>
<DT><B>参数:</B><DD><CODE>text</CODE> - 公文域的内容<DD><CODE>startX</CODE> - 左上角的x坐标<DD><CODE>startY</CODE> - 左上角的y坐标<DD><CODE>endX</CODE> - 右下角的x坐标<DD><CODE>endY</CODE> - 右下角的y坐标
<DT><B>返回:</B><DD>String 返回插入公文域的名字<p><b>例子:</b> <pre> //在文字处理中添加一文本为"发送机关"的公文域。 Shapes shapes = Application.getWorkbooks().getActiveWorkbook().getActiveShapes(); shapes.addDocField("发文机关", 120, 180, 380, 380); </pre>
<DT><B>抛出:</B>
<DD><CODE><A HREF="../../../../../application/exceptions/MacroRunException.html" title="application.exceptions 中的类">MacroRunException</A></CODE> - 当无法插入公文域,或者并非在文字处理中插入时。</DL>
</DD>
</DL>
<HR>
<A NAME="addShape(application.workbooks.workbook.documents.document.TextRange, int, double, double, double, double)"><!-- --></A><H3>
addShape</H3>
<PRE>
public <A HREF="../../../../../application/workbooks/workbook/shapes/Shape.html" title="application.workbooks.workbook.shapes 中的类">Shape</A> <B>addShape</B>(<A HREF="../../../../../application/workbooks/workbook/documents/document/TextRange.html" title="application.workbooks.workbook.documents.document 中的类">TextRange</A> anchor,
int type,
double startX,
double startY,
double endX,
double endY)</PRE>
<DL>
<DD>添加一个自选图形到指定的文档位置。
<P>
<DD><DL>
<DT><B>参数:</B><DD><CODE>anchor</CODE> - 指定添加自选图形的锚点位置,是一个TextRange对象。自选图形的锚点位置指向这个文本范围的开头所在段落的起始位置。<DD><CODE>type</CODE> - 自选图形的类型,其取值和相应的自选图形如下: <pre> ShapeConstants.SHAPE_RECTANGLE 矩形 ShapeConstants.SHAPE_PARALLELOGRAM 平行四边形 ShapeConstants.SHAPE_TRAPEZOID 梯形 ShapeConstants.SHAPE_DIAMOND 菱形 ShapeConstants.SHAPE_ROUNDED_RECTANGLE 圆角矩形 ShapeConstants.SHAPE_OCTAGON 八边形 ShapeConstants.SHAPE_ISOSCELES_TRIANGLE 等腰三角形 ShapeConstants.SHAPE_RIGHT_TRIANGLE 右三角 ShapeConstants.SHAPE_OVAL 椭圆 ShapeConstants.SHAPE_HEXAGON 六边形 ShapeConstants.SHAPE_CROSS 十字形 ShapeConstants.SHAPE_REGULAR_PENTAGON 正五边形 ShapeConstants.SHAPE_CAN 圆柱形 ShapeConstants.SHAPE_CUBE 立方体 ShapeConstants.SHAPE_BEVEL 棱台 ShapeConstants.SHAPE_FOLDED_CORNER 折角形 ShapeConstants.SHAPE_SMILEY_FACE 笑脸 ShapeConstants.SHAPE_DONUT 同心圆 ShapeConstants.SHAPE_NO_SYMBOL 禁止符 ShapeConstants.SHAPE_BLOCK_ARC 空心弧 ShapeConstants.SHAPE_HEART 心形 ShapeConstants.SHAPE_LIGHTNING_BOLT 闪电形 ShapeConstants.SHAPE_SUN 太阳形 ShapeConstants.SHAPE_MOON 新月形 ShapeConstants.SHAPE_ARC 弧形 ShapeConstants.SHAPE_DOUBLE_BRACKET 双括号 ShapeConstants.SHAPE_DOUBLE_BRACE 双大括号 ShapeConstants.SHAPE_PLAQUE 缺角矩形 ShapeConstants.SHAPE_LEFT_BRACKET 左小括号 ShapeConstants.SHAPE_RIGHT_BRACKET 右小括号 ShapeConstants.SHAPE_LEFT_BRACE 左大括号 ShapeConstants.SHAPE_RIGHT_BRACE 右大括号 ShapeConstants.SHAPE_RIGHT_ARROW 右箭头 ShapeConstants.SHAPE_LEFT_ARROW 左箭头 ShapeConstants.SHAPE_UP_ARROW 上箭头 ShapeConstants.SHAPE_DOWN_ARROW 下箭头 ShapeConstants.SHAPE_LEFT_RIGHT_ARROW 左右箭头 ShapeConstants.SHAPE_UP_DOWN_ARROW 上下箭头 ShapeConstants.SHAPE_QUAD_ARROW 十字箭头 ShapeConstants.SHAPE_LEFT_RIGHT_UP_ARROW 丁字箭头 ShapeConstants.SHAPE_BENT_ARROW 圆角右箭头 ShapeConstants.SHAPE_U_TURN_ARROW 手杖形箭头 ShapeConstants.SHAPE_LEFT_UP_ARROW 直角双向箭头 ShapeConstants.SHAPE_BNET_UP_ARROW 直角上箭头 ShapeConstants.SHAPE_CURVED_RIGHT_ARROW 右弧形箭头 ShapeConstants.SHAPE_CURVED_LEFT_ARROW 左弧形箭头 ShapeConstants.SHAPE_CURVED_UP_ARROW 上弧形箭头 ShapeConstants.SHAPE_CURVED_DOWN_ARROW 下弧形箭头 ShapeConstants.SHAPE_STRIPED_RIGHT_ARROW 虚尾箭头 ShapeConstants.SHAPE_NOTCHED_RIGHT_ARROW 燕尾形箭头 ShapeConstants.SHAPE_PENTAGON 五边形 ShapeConstants.SHAPE_CHEVRON 燕尾形 ShapeConstants.SHAPE_RIGHT_ARROW_CALLOUT 右箭头标注 ShapeConstants.SHAPE_LEFT_ARROW_CALLOUT 左箭头标注 ShapeConstants.SHAPE_UP_ARROW_CALLOUT 上箭头标注 ShapeConstants.SHAPE_DOWN_ARROW_CALLOUT 下箭头标注 ShapeConstants.SHAPE_LEFT_RIGHT_ARROW_CALLOUT 左右箭头标注 ShapeConstants.SHAPE_UP_DOWN_ARROW_CALLOUT 上下箭头标注 ShapeConstants.SHAPE_QUAD_ARROW_CALLOUT 十字箭头标注 ShapeConstants.SHAPE_CIRCULAR_ARROW 环形箭头标注 ShapeConstants.SHAPE_FLOWCHART_PROCESS 流程图过程 ShapeConstants.SHAPE_FLOWCHART_ALTERNATE_PROCESS 流程图可选过程 ShapeConstants.SHAPE_FLOWCHART_DECISION 流程图决策 ShapeConstants.SHAPE_FLOWCHART_DATA 流程图数据 ShapeConstants.SHAPE_FLOWCHART_PREDEFINED_PROCESS 流程图预定义过程 ShapeConstants.SHAPE_FLOWCHART_INTERNAL_STORAGE 流程图内部贮存 ShapeConstants.SHAPE_FLOWCHART_DOCUMENT 流程图文档 ShapeConstants.SHAPE_FLOWCHART_MULTIDOCUMENT 流程图多文档 ShapeConstants.SHAPE_FLOWCHART_TERMINATOR 流程图终止 ShapeConstants.SHAPE_FLOWCHART_PREPARATION 流程图准备 ShapeConstants.SHAPE_FLOWCHART_MANUAL_INPUT 流程图人工输入 ShapeConstants.SHAPE_FLOWCHART_MANUAL_OPERATION 流程图人工操作 ShapeConstants.SHAPE_FLOWCHART_CONNECTOR 流程图联系 ShapeConstants.SHAPE_FLOWCHART_OFFPAGE_CONNECTOR 流程图离页连接符 ShapeConstants.SHAPE_FLOWCHART_CARD 流程图卡片 ShapeConstants.SHAPE_FLOWCHART_PUNCHED_TAPE 流程图资料带
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-